Menswear Allure of European Old Money Style

Yachting and Tennis Elegance in Modern Menswear - discussed by MMSCENE Magazine's Fashion Editors:

Menswear has its core definitions clearly setup, however trends do come and go, however the definition of elegant is dominated with tried out classics for decades. There is a point in menswear when we go back to the styles that evoke the sophistication and understated luxury of European old money. This Spring Summer 2024 menswear season, the spotlight returns to two of the most iconic sports associated with this elite class—yachting and tennis. These sports have not only influenced leisure activities among the affluent but have also significantly shaped contemporary fashion trends, blending tradition with modernity to create a look that is both timeless and fresh.

Yachting Elegance: A Nautical Legacy in Menswear

The influence of yachting on menswear can be traced back to the maritime traditions of European aristocracy, where functionality met finesse. However, today the quintessential yachting attire is not just a nod to nautical aesthetics but also of practical luxury. Key elements include blazers in navy or crisp white, paired with well-fitted slacks or chinos. These pieces are often crafted and knit out of finest materials, from silk to merino wool.

Breton stripes, originally worn by French sailors, have transcended their practical origins to become staples in the wardrobes of the style-conscious. This pattern is not only timeless but also versatile, pairing seamlessly with everything from casual denim to tailored trousers. Footwear, too, plays a crucial role, with boat shoes and loafers rounding out the look, offering both comfort and a touch of elegance suitable for a deck or a dockside soiree.

The Return of Tennis Whites: A Trend Revival Inspired by the Silver Screen

This season, tennis fashion makes a vigorous comeback, invigorated by its depiction in Luca Guadagnino’s film “The Challengers“, starring Zendaya, Mike Faist, and Josh O’Connor. The movie has sparked a renewed interest in classic tennis whites, which symbolize both the sport’s strict heritage and a chic, minimalist aesthetic. The traditional polo shirts, pleated shorts, and crisp, lightweight trousers are emblematic of a refined yet active lifestyle that balances athleticism with grace. The resurgence of tennis-inspired fashion is not merely a nostalgic revival but a celebration of clean lines and functional beauty. The color palette remains predominantly white, punctuated with occasional splashes of navy or forest green, maintaining a connection to the sport’s elegant roots while allowing for modern interpretations and styling. Accessories such as headbands, wristbands, and vintage taken tennis sneakers complement the outfits, enhancing the sporty yet sophisticated vibe quickly coined as tennis-core.

Blending Traditions: Modern Interpretations of Old Money Style

The modern adaptation of these styles speaks to a broader trend of revisiting and revitalizing traditional menswear. Today’s designers are weaving the essence of old money style—discreet luxury and a connection to leisurely heritage sports—into contemporary garments. This approach not only honors the past but also makes these styles relevant for today’s fashion-forward man.

Outerwear, such as the timeless trench coat or the structured peacoat, bridges seasonal styles while maintaining a link to the maritime and sporty origins of these looks. Similarly, accessories such as silk scarves, nautical-inspired watches, and classic sunglasses add a layer of old-world charm to any outfit, ensuring that the wearer stands out with a style that is both heritage-infused and distinctly modern. Embracing Sustainability: The New Luxury Standard

An essential aspect of modern menswear, influenced by the principles of old money style, is the focus on sustainability. As today’s consumers become more environmentally conscious, they gravitate towards brands that not only offer style and tradition but also commit to ethical practices and sustainability. This shift mirrors the old money values of longevity and quality over fleeting trends, with an increased emphasis on garments that offer both style and sustainability.

Finally, the return of yachting and tennis superstars on menswear is showing how quickly the fashion industry embraced quite luxury, for many fuelled by TV shows such as Succession, which continues to inspire fashion that is bringing back the classical men’s dressing. As we see a revival of these trends, driven by the mentioned cinematic portrayals and a deeper appreciation of heritage sports, it becomes clear that the blend of tradition with modern design sensibilities is more than just a fashion statement. It is also a massive drive for the fashion industry, bringing to surface European heritage brands. This season, as tennis whites and notes of the Succession style dominate the scene, they bring with them a timeless charm that is sure to prevail in the not easy to shape story of men’s fashion.
